Transaction 58cefd6efbec506b7992465e99602411978a2382dfb4bee8b68c4f05d5b90df8

2 Input
2 Outputs
  • 58cefd6efbec506b7992465e99602411978a2382dfb4bee8b68c4f05d5b90df8:0
  • value  2711065
    address  1Enf9R6QhzsYU2vgGdCApUhAo7RaGD7LBB
  • 58cefd6efbec506b7992465e99602411978a2382dfb4bee8b68c4f05d5b90df8:1
  • value  659
    address  16EhXGGTo3TJKLXakPMXm9hrTsWGYEArFM